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Cressing (Essex) to Lanark start from as little as £46.20

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Cressing (Essex) to Lanark start from £103.40 one way, or £219.30 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Cressing (Essex) to Lanark are available for £132.80 one way, or £469.00 return

Facilities and Amenities at Cressing (Essex)

When arriving at Cressing (Essex) station, passengers will notice the absence of a traditional ticket office. However, fear not, as ticket machines are on hand for both ticket collection and purchase, ensuring you’re ready to board your train. Furthermore, these machines are accessible, catering to everyone’s needs. Customer information is easily accessible through departure screens and announcements, while a help point is available for any assistance needed.

For those requiring accessibility features, the station boasts step-free access to the single platform serving trains to Braintree and Witham. It’s classified as a Category B1 station by the Office of Rail and Road (ORR), indicating that step-free access is available in parts. Unfortunately, there's a lack of accessible bathrooms or waiting rooms on site, but a comfortable seating area is available for those waiting for onward travel.

Facilities and Amenities

Lanark station offers a variety of facilities catering to both everyday commuters and occasional travelers. The ticket office is open Monday to Saturday from 06:20 to 20:25, providing ample time for travelers to buy and collect tickets. Although there are no Sunday services, the ticket machines onsite remain available for fast and accessible service for collecting tickets purchased online.

Accessibility is a top priority at Lanark station. It's categorized as a Category A station, offering step-free access throughout, although care should be taken at platform 1 due to potential height differences. While the station doesn’t feature accessible toilets or lounges, there are three Blue Badge parking bays available in the 24-hour freely available car park that has CCTV security for added peace of mind.

Support and Accessibility Services

The station is equipped with customer help points and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ring support is on hand if needed. Should you require assistance, staff help is available throughout the week, and additional help can be scheduled in advance via the Passenger Assist Service.
